Authoring tools are programs that allow users to create interactive materials that can be uploaded to web pages and used in computer labs. These activities can also be used offline. In connection with this, the authoring tool called “Hot Potatoes” is, in the authors’ opinion, a valuable teaching resource because of its user friendly capabilities, didactic possibilities, and compatibility with various operating systems such as Windows (for which there is a specific installer) and Mac and Linux by downloading Java Hot Potatoes and running it on Java Virtual Machine.
Hot Potatoes consists of 7 programs that can be used to make practice questions, namely:
JQuiz: Program for compiling multiple choice training materials.
JMix: Program for making exercises to compose sentences.
JCross: Program for compiling material in the form of crosswords.
JMatch: A program for making exercises with match making models.
JCloze: Program for structuring exercises in essay forms.
The Masher: This program creates units by combining different exercises developed with some or all of the previously described programs. This program also adds the necessary hyperlinks to connect all the activities, and it also creates a unit menu on the first page of a unit.
One of them that emphasizes in reading skill is JCloze. In JCloze, the program is suitable for creating cloze and fill-in-the-blank exercises. The blanks generated by this program can also be substituted for a dropdown menu with all the options that students are expected to enter, or users can insert a word blank to help students complete any given activity.
